Protein tags are protein sequences that are artificially inserted into a protein sequence. Tags can be of natural origin, or they can be designed according to their specific requirements. They may represent a short peptide epitope, or they may comprise entire proteins or protein domains. Tags allow the detection of labeled proteins by different methods like immunoblotting, ELISA, fluorescent detection and more.